Zeppelin is a web-based notebook (like Jupyter for Python) from the. This is typically a good thing, but in this case it prevents us from being able to enter a URL with all of the necessary SSL information appended at the end. DBeaver is similar to pgAdmin and OmniDB, with support for more RDBMS servers. The tool simplifies setting up a connection by taking the host, database and port information in separate input boxes. Even in the advanced settings, it does not connect properly through SSL. The problem is that in the new connection interface, DBeaver does not have anywhere to enter the SSL info. Unfortunately DBeaver does not currently have the ability to enter SSL information, or a connection string directly in the connection wizard like the other tools listed above.Īfter lots of searching, I was able to find the hacked answer on the DBeaver GitHub repo, but I wanted to lay it out a little more explicitly for any other folks searching out there. This feature is available only in Windows and macOS. Recently I needed to connect to a DB2 database with SSL enabled and I wanted to do it through DBeaver. NOTE: To upgrade DBeaver to the next version, use sudo rpm -Uvh dbeaver-.rpm parameter. DBeaver Universal Database Tool Free multi-platform database tool for developers, database administrators, analysts and all people who need to work with databases.Some other free SQL clients for Mac that I would recommend include: Sequel Pro, TablePlus and SQquirrel SQL. Easily connect to your MySQL hosting deployments at ScaleGrid from Python applications to optimize your MySQL management in the cloud.How to Connect to. It has a simple interface and connects to a wide range of different data sources. My current SQL client of choice is DBeaver. If you're on Windows, download Python from. Step 1: Install DBeaver Community Edition Step 2: Download PostgreSQL JDBC Driver Step 3: Create a Connection to PostgreSQL Data Step 4: Query Data Install DBeaver Community Edition You can download the relevant DBeaver Community Edition based on your Operating System from its official website. SQL editor with smart auto-completion and syntax highlighting. SSH tunnels for remote databases connectivity. Data export and migration in multiple formats. Allows to manipulate with data like in a regular spreadsheet. That you have python 3 installed, if you don't, go here and download the latest version.īest Platform to Learn Python Programming Language?Īssuming you're on windows, go download python from .īase/palette for practise/pasting my own code?įor that you just need any text editor, plus Python. Main features: Supports multiple databases. Ideally you would remove all of the existing PATH entries and install whichever version of Python you want with the default settings to ensure you get the launcher if you don't already have it. It's installed by default when you install Python from. I would recommend against adding Python to your PATH and instead use the py launcher. Im trying to set up python 3.8.10 and its not being added to path This file is hidden, so keep that in mind when you look for it. For me, it was in this location /.dbeaver/General/.dbeaver-data-sources.xml. I love and always looking at their Latest News section, and I am not gonna lie, it does serve the purpose to some extent. Follow these steps (My DBeaver version was 3.5.8 and it was on Mac OsX El Capitan) Locate the file in which DBeaver stores the connection details. Which is your favourite or go-to YouTube channel for being up-to-date on Python? I've been using DBeaver () for years now though - it's occasionally a little rough around the edges, but overall it's really amazing! It uses jdbc drivers for database support, so it can handle basically anything. DBeaver is a java application (hence it uses a driver specifically for java, for example it uses either db2jcc.jar or more typically db2jcc4.jar and a licence-file to connect to the remote database, for certain platforms). I've tried a bunch, but many of the prettier ones don't have Linux versions. Replicating data from other databases to CrateDB with Debezium and KafkaĬonnect to the instance with a client such as sqlcmd, SSMS, or DBeaver. Since PGAdmin III is not a thing anymore, I switched to DBeaver. The psycopg fully implements the Python DB-API 2. Currently, the psycopg is the most popular PostgreSQL database adapter for the Python language. Never used or heard about TablePlus, so don't know how it compares but I have been using community edition for years now and it's my go to tool for interacting with relational databases. Python has various database drivers for PostgreSQL. There is a BigQuery Python Client Library available for the users to query. EDIT: Since the main page buries it a bit, here's a direct link to the free Community Edition. SQLPro for MSSQL, Navicat for SQL Server, and DBeaver are probably your best.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|